Solsona City Council has secured a 319,000 euro grant from the Generalitat de Catalunya shock plan to finance the modernization of the city's main sports facilities during the 2025-2029 period.

This allocation will finance 70% of three key actions: the renovation of the sports pavilion, the improvement of the municipal swimming pools, and the conditioning of the outdoor courts on Pedraforca street.
The largest project, budgeted at 286,000 euros, will focus on rehabilitating the changing rooms and renovating the court and lighting of the old pavilion. Additionally, 100,000 euros will be invested in replacing the fibrocement roof of the swimming pool building, and 70,000 euros will condition the outdoor multi-sport courts, formerly the site of the El Vinyet school.

"It represents a significant boost for updating municipal sports facilities, with fundamental works for their safety, sustainability, and functionality."

Joan Parcerisa · Councillor for Urban Planning, Public Works, and Sports
The granting of these funds was made possible by Solsona grouping together with the municipalities of Castellar de la Ribera, Pinell de Solsonès, Llobera, and Guixers. This collaboration allowed the capital of Solsonès to qualify for the 10,001 to 20,000 inhabitants bracket, reaching 319,000 euros, far exceeding the maximum 160,000 euros it would have received based on its actual population.
